Latest Patents
One of his key inventions is an absolute pressure sensor. This device includes a base layer, a sensor layer, and a reference layer. The base layer features a passageway that connects a pressure inlet to a mounting face. The sensor layer is bonded by an insulating bond to the mounting face and incorporates a conductive diaphragm. The reference layer is mounted on the sensor layer, creating a reference vacuum cavity. This layer includes a conducting surface that faces the conductive diaphragm across the reference vacuum cavity, forming a pressure sensing capacitor. Nelson holds 1 patent for this innovative technology.
